Launch Of Gold Wafers To Aid Charity Efforts

Yayasan Prihatin Nasional (PRIHATIN), in partnership with Public Gold Group, has inaugurated the PRIHATIN Gold Bar, marked by a ceremony officiated by the Crown Princess of Perlis, HRH Tengku Sharifah Khatreena Nuraniah Binti DYTM Tuanku Syed Faizuddin Jamalullail, held at Menara Public Gold.

The Gold Wafers, known as ‘Prihatin Duo Hearts’, boasting a purity of up to 999.9, signify a joint effort by PRIHATIN and PUBLIC GOLD to raise funds for the PRIHATIN Charity Fund.

These funds will be directed towards expanding educational assistance for outstanding students, providing healthcare aid for the underprivileged, and extending disaster relief assistance.

PRIHATIN’s dedication to proactive welfare programs, particularly in elevating Malaysia’s education sector globally, remains steadfast. In 2024 alone, PRIHATIN has assisted over 8,000 financially challenged students, emphasizing inclusivity and support across various fields, including education and disaster relief.

Yayasan Prihatin Nasional, CEO, Datuk Aizuddin Ghazali, CEO of Yayasan Prihatin Nasional, lauded the strategic collaboration with Public Gold Group, citing the production of gold wafers as a prudent step towards long-term investment.

The ‘PRIHATIN Duo Hearts’ design, symbolising purity and sincerity, is expected to resonate with avid gold collectors due to its unique charitable aspect.

Public Gold, Founder and Executive Chairman, Datuk Wira Louis emphasised the collaborative effort’s significance in promoting gold savings among the youth.

With a target of raising RM200,000.00 for the PRIHATIN Charity Fund through the sales of ‘PRIHATIN Duo Hearts’ gold wafers, Public Gold aims to make a meaningful impact on individuals in need, especially students.

In addition to the launch event, PRIHATIN also organised a grand Iftar event at the Federal Territory level, celebrating orphans, tahfiz children, single mothers, needy individuals, and students from Higher Education Institutions (IPT) in collaboration with Non-Governmental Organisations.
